Set mouseEnabled=true on the TitleWindow

Hi all,

I followed the Alex's Popup Dialogs as Modules blog entry:
http://blogs.adobe.com/aharui/2007/08/popup_dialogs_as_modules.html

It works with mx.containers.TitleWindow as intended, the context menu
shows and I can copy/paste text in a TextArea.

But if I try to use spark.components.TitleWindow, the context menu does
not shows at all when right clicking in spark TextArea.

Application code:
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<s:Application xmlns:fx="http://ns.adobe.com/mxml/2009";
 xmlns:s="library://ns.adobe.com/flex/spark"
 xmlns:mx="library://ns.adobe.com/flex/mx" minWidth="955"
minHeight="600">

<fx:Script>
<![CDATA[
 import mx.core.IVisualElement;
 import mx.events.ModuleEvent;
 import mx.modules.IModuleInfo;
 import mx.modules.ModuleManager;

private var info:IModuleInfo;

protected function loadModule(event:MouseEvent):void
 {
 info = ModuleManager.getModule("HelloModule.swf");
 info.addEventListener(ModuleEvent.READY, modEventHandler);
 info.load(null, null, null, moduleFactory);
 }

private function modEventHandler(event:ModuleEvent):void
 {
 addElement(info.factory.create() as IVisualElement);
 }

]]>
</fx:Script>

<s:Button label="loadModule" click="loadModule(event)" />

</s:Application>

module code:
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<local:ModuleTitleWindow xmlns:fx="http://ns.adobe.com/mxml/2009";
 xmlns:s="library://ns.adobe.com/flex/spark"
 xmlns:mx="library://ns.adobe.com/flex/mx"
 xmlns:local="*"
 width="400" height="300">

<s:TextArea width="100%" height="100%" />

</local:ModuleTitleWindow>

package
{
 import spark.components.TitleWindow;

[Frame(factoryClass="mx.core.FlexModuleFactory")]
 public class ModuleTitleWindow extends TitleWindow
 {
 public function ModuleTitleWindow()
 {
 super();
 }
 }
}

Any thoughts? Is there a workaround?
